Acta Cryst. (2009). E65, o2427-o2428 [ doi:10.1107/S160053680903565X ]
Abstract: The main molecule of the title compound, C37H36·CDCl3, is a hydrocarbon with two naphthalene segments attached to opposite ends of a rigid norbornylogous spacer with an overall structure that is approximately C-shaped. The dihedral angle between the naphthalene ring planes is 9.27 (7)°. The cleft that exists between the naphthalene rings is large enough that the compound crystallizes with a solvent molecule (CDCl3) in the cleft.
